Scotland: Abusive man gets 8 years prison for wife's suicide
"Lee Milne physically and psychologically abused Kimberly Bruce (Milne) and our evidence showed that this abuse was a significant contributing factor in her death. He deliberately and ruthlessly exploited Kimberly's vulnerabilities, which makes him culpable for her decision to end her own life."
"Domestic abuse is rarely about one incident. It's not only about violent acts, it includes more subtle, but nonetheless as harmful, exertions of power and control in a relationship."
Lee Milne received an eight-year prison sentence for culpable homicide after his wife, Kimberly, committed suicide due to his abusive behavior. Kimberly, 28, died by jumping from a bridge in Dundee on July 27, 2023. Evidence presented included physical, emotional, and financial abuse, with CCTV footage showing Milne's aggressive actions on the day of her death. Prosecutors argued that Milne exploited Kimberly's vulnerabilities, contributing significantly to her decision to end her life. The case is notable as it is the first in Scotland to hold a spouse criminally responsible for a partner's suicide.
